什么是比特币交易链区块拥堵? 比特币是一种基于区块链技术的数字货币,它的交易数据被记录在一个称为比特币交...
比特币作为第一个成功的去中心化数字货币,其背后的区块链技术不仅仅是一个简单的公共账本,更是蕴含了丰富的特性和指标,这些特性和指标也是比特币能够成功运作的基础。本文将详尽介绍比特币区块链的特性指标,包括但不限于去中心化、透明性、安全性、不可篡改性、可编程性以及可扩展性等,同时我们还会解答一些与比特币区块链特性相关的常见问题。
去中心化是比特币区块链的核心特性之一。相比传统金融系统的集中管理,去中心化意味着没有任何单一的实体或机构能够控制整个网络。这使得比特币成为了一种更加公平和民主的金融工具。
去中心化的实现是通过节点的分布式网络。每一个参与者都可以成为一个节点,所有的交易信息都通过广播的方式传递给整个网络中的所有节点。这种机制在很大程度上提高了系统的抗审查性和抗干扰能力。
去中心化还带来了隐私保护,因为用户的身份信息并不是以中心化的方式存储,而是通过加密地址进行交易,降低了个人信息泄露的风险。此外,去中心化还提高了系统的稳定性。当某个节点出现故障时,其他节点依然可以继续运作,这种冗余系统确保了网络的持续性。
透明性是区块链技术的另一项重要特性。比特币网络上所有的交易记录都是公开的,任何人都可以通过区块链浏览器查阅到任意时间的交易历史。这种透明性使得每一笔交易都可以被审计,帮助提高系统的可信度。
透明性不仅增强了用户之间的信任,还使得任何潜在的欺诈行为都能被及时发现。例如,如果某一笔交易存在问题,任何用户都可以通过查看区块链历史记录追查该交易,了解其来源和去向。这种公开透明的特性有助于维护市场的公平性,降低了系统内部的腐败风险。
比特币区块链的安全性主要体现在两个方面:加密算法和网络的共识机制。比特币使用了SHA-256的加密算法,为每一笔交易和区块提供了强大的安全保障。
此外,比特币还采用了工作量证明(Proof of Work, PoW)机制,以确保交易的有效性。在这个机制下,矿工们需要通过计算能力去“挖掘”区块,确保只有合法的交易能够被纳入区块链中。这一过程不仅增加了恶意攻击的难度,也为比特币的安全性提供了保障。
当网络越大时,对于攻击者而言,控制大部分算力所需的成本就越高,这使得比特币网络的安全性得以提高。这种基于算力的安全机制是比特币在竞争中保持信任的关键。
不可篡改性是指一旦在区块链上记录的交易信息就无法被修改或删除。这是区块链技术的一大优势,为用户提供了安心,因为这意味着历史交易记录是值得信赖的。
不可篡改性的实现是通过区块链数据结构特性和加密算法的结合。当一个区块被添加到区块链上后,每个区块都包含了前一个区块的哈希值,这建立了一个连锁关系。如果有人试图修改某个区块中的数据,所有后续区块的哈希值都会变化,进而使得网络中的其他节点能够识别出这一作弊行为。
这种特性能有效防范双重支付攻击和其他恶意行为,使得交易结果能够被广泛信赖,同时为各种应用场景提供了更高的安全标准。
比特币虽然主要作为一种数字货币,但其智能合约的功能也逐渐显露出其可编程性。虽然比特币的脚本语言相对较简单,但它依然能够执行一些基本的编程逻辑,如多重签名、时间锁等。
在比特币上,可以通过设置一些简单的逻辑实现自动执行的条件交易,例如条件A满足后自动释放比特币资金给指定的接收方。这为不同的商业模式和金融工具的开发带来了可能性。
尽管相比于以太坊等其他区块链平台,比特币的可编程性较为限制,但其仍然为区块链技术的扩展与应用提供了更广泛的可能性。
可扩展性是比特币区块链面临的挑战之一。随着比特币用户的增加和交易量的上升,区块链的处理速度和存储容量都受到了一定的限制。目前,比特币网络每秒只能处理大约7笔交易,远远不能与传统支付网络(如Visa等)相提并论。
为了提高可扩展性,比特币社区提出了一些解决方案,例如闪电网络(Lightning Network),这是一种二层解决方案,允许用户以链下方式处理小额支付,从而减轻主链的负担。
除了闪电网络,其他技术(如分片、合并操作、以及更高效的共识算法)也在不断被研究和探讨,以应对比特币区块链的可扩展性问题,从而能够支持更大规模的用户交易需求。
去中心化在比特币网络中是通过一个分布式的节点网络完成的。在传统金融体系中,所有的交易和数据都存储在中心服务器上,由某个管理者控制。而在比特币网络中,每个人都可以成为一个节点,所有的交易信息都以相同的方式在全体节点之间进行传输。每个节点都有完整的区块链副本,并通过共识机制来验证交易。
在比特币中,工作量证明(PoW)作为一种共识机制,它要求矿工通过解决复杂的数学问题来确认交易并添加新的区块。当矿工成功地完成这些计算并找到正确的哈希值时,他们将获得比特币的奖励。这一过程确保了网络的安全性,让节点在不依赖中心化机构的情况下完成交易。
去中心化的运作使得任何试图操控网络行为的攻击者都需要控制51%以上的计算能力,这在现实中极为困难。即使攻击者成功控制了一部分节点,网络仍然会继续运作,并只会拦截其所在的节点。通过这种方式,比特币的去中心化特性有效地保护了用户的交易安全。
比特币的透明性来源于在区块链上公开的每一笔交易记录,任何人都可以随时查看到交易的详细信息。这种设计降低了交易的不确定性,使得所有用户均处于相同的信息水平上。这种透明度不仅限于交易的金额和发送方、接收方的地址,还包含了交易的时间戳和区块高度等信息。
一个透明的环境意味着用户可以轻松追踪资金的来源和去向,这对维护市场的公平性至关重要。在一个完全透明的系统中,用户可以清楚地看到每一笔交易的流动情况,从而降低潜在的欺诈风险。即使一个用户想要恶意改变自己的交易历史,这也几乎不可能,因为整个网络的用户都能够轻易识别并驳斥这种行为。
此外,透明性还提高了社区的自我治理能力。比特币的开发者和用户可以监控网络上的资金流动,社区能够在数据的基础上做出更明智的决策,提高了网络的参与度和治理能力。
比特币的安全性主要与两大核心组件相关:加密技术和分布式的网络结构。首先,比特币采用了高度复杂的加密算法(如SHA-256)来确保交易的安全。在交易发起时,用户使用私钥对交易信息进行数字签名,确保交易的真实性和唯一性。该密钥只有授权人员才能访问,确保其安全。
而其次,分布式的节点结构又为比特币提供了强有力的安全保障。网络中的每个节点都存储着完整的区块链,它们共同组成整个网络的防护体系。即使有人试图攻击并修改账本,网络中的其他节点也能够迅速识别出这一不正当行为,维护网络的完整性。
此外,工作量证明机制也为比特币网络的安全提供了保障。在这一机制下,矿工需要投入大量的计算能力才能获得挖矿奖励,因此若有人想要通过51%攻击来篡改交易,他需要数倍于所有其他矿工的资源投入,这在现实中几乎是不可能的情形。
比特币区块链的不可篡改性来源于其独特的数据结构和加密技术。每一个区块都不仅仅包含了交易数据,还包含了前一个区块的哈希值和时间戳,这为所有的区块建立起了链式的关系。只要一个区块被添加到区块链中,任何对该区块内容的改动都将导致需要重新计算所有后续区块的哈希值,这在技术上是极其困难且耗时的。
此外,比特币网络的去中心化特性意味着,范围广泛的节点都维护着这本“账本”。即使某个节点受到损坏或被恶意篡改,其他节点也无法得到相同的信息,从而维持数据的一致性。这使得任何篡改历史交易记录的行为都易于被识别和拒绝。
这种不可篡改性为比特币提供了强有力的信任基础,用户可以确信他们的交易历史是安全且不能被更改的,这极大地提高了用户参与和使用比特币的信心。
比特币的可编程性虽然不如以太坊等平台强大,但它依然为其生态发展提供了重要基础。可编程性为比特币引入了智能合约的理念,即根据预设条件自动执行交易。通过简单的条件逻辑,在某些情况下,用户可以设置时间锁、多个签名等,进一步提升了比特币的应用灵活性。
随着理解和使用比特币的人群日益增加,仅仅将其视为储值工具可能会限制其应用潜力。可编程钱包允许用户在发送和接收比特币时加入条件,这种提升的功能为未来的金融产品和服务的开发打开了新局面。
如果比特币能够进一步扩展其可编程性,将能引入更多的商业模型和应用场景,使得作为数字货币的比特币不仅仅局限于价值转移,也能涵盖更多金融智能合约的应用,如信贷和保险等,因此其生态系统将更加丰富。
比特币网络的可扩展性问题是一个复杂且具有挑战性的课题。随着用户和交易需求的增长,如何保证网络的快速交易处理能力已成为关键问题。目前的解决方案主要包括以下几种:
首先,闪电网络(Lightning Network)作为一种二层解决方案,允许用户在链下进行小额支付并将最终结算结果记录在主链上,这大大降低了主链的负担,提升了交易处理速度。
此外,分片技术也是一个备受关注的解决方案。如果能够将区块链中的数据分割成不同的部分,并在不同的节点上独立处理,将会显著提高整个网络的处理能力。
理论上,这些解决方案都具有可行性,但具体实施仍需技术上的突破与广泛的社区共识。此外,为了确保扩展性与安全性之间的平衡,开发者也需要在网络性能和防御机制之间寻找最佳的解决方案。
总之,比特币区块链的特性指标不仅关系到其技术架构的稳固性,还对其未来的发展方向产生重大影响。理解这些特性与问题有助于用户更深入地参与这一正在快速演变的行业。